WebApr 6, 2024 · In tandem with the Malaysian Government’s agenda to drive the growth of Malaysia’s green economy, an announcement of green technology tax incentives in the Budget 2014 has been introduced where … WebAug 28, 2015 · Malaysian Green Tech Initiatives. Green technology is already a significant part of the Malaysian economy (it contributed RM7.9 billion or 0.8% to GDP in 2013), but the country has much larger goals in mind. By 2030, the country aims to have a green tech sector contributing RM60 billion to the GDP, with an interim target of RM22 billion in 2024.
